The Authority is exploring the potential to establish a direct contractual arrangement with a chlorine tablet supplier. The purpose of the contract is to ensure a resilient and prioritised supply of chlorine disinfectant combination tablets with detergent 1.7g NaDCC in the event of a national pandemic or public health emergency. As part of this arrangement, the supplier would be required to hold sufficient raw materials (NaDCC) and packaging components to enable production of circa. 9-30 million chlorine tablets (“materials”). *This volume range is an estimate only and subject to final confirmation at the Invitation to Tender (ITT) stage.
The arrangement would operate independently of the Authority’s existing Chlorine Framework [2024/S 000-039165] and must ensure timely delivery continuity in the event of a national pandemic or public health emergency conditions, including those resulting in UK border closures (“emergency conditions”).

This contractual agreement will operate outside of the Authority’s existing Chlorine Framework.
The Authority must be granted priority access to the materials during any pandemic or emergency conditions period.
The supplier will be expected to sustain continuous supply of the chlorine tablets to the Authority for the full duration of the emergency conditions.
